Overview

The forensic pathology fellowship at the Medical University of South Carolina allows trainees to complete their forensic pathology training in a major academic center in the beautiful city of Charleston, South Carolina. Being located in the University hospital provides trainees with access to vast resources within the department and university. Additionally, the case variety is extremely rich as cases are referred to MUSC from a variety of settings from all over the state of South Carolina
